Bug#299122: totem: snd_intel8x0m is not installed by default in etch

i just did a clean etch debian-installer installation.  it appears that the snd_intel8x0m kernel driver is no longer loaded into the kernel as a default part of the installation any more.  this means that totem works without blacklisting snd_intel8x0m on a new install.  i even tried modprobing snd_intel8x0m into the kernel.  totem works under this scenario.  i don't know what has been fixed, but it works like a charm now.  you can close this bug if you like.
